Smarter preparation for Improve

Hello, SKLOTOPOLIS!

Keybinder 0.7.6 can prepare an external world object automatically: it selects
the exact target, sends a quiet Examine, waits for the server response without
freezing the client, and then continues the keybind. This release also fixes
partially used marble, slate, and sandstone shards not being found.

What is new in 0.7.6?

Automatic external-object preparation

Smart Improve no longer requires the player to double-click Examine before
improving a forge, altar, fence, or another external object. For Hover,
Selected, and exact-object targets, Keybinder now pins and selects the exact
target, sends a quiet Examine, waits asynchronously for its improvement data,
and safely resumes the remaining keybind steps.

Queued Smart Improve actions for the same target can reuse their known
requirement while still respecting the live action queue.

Partially used stone shards

Marble, slate, and sandstone shards remain valid improvement resources after
their first use, including when the Wurm client reports the shortened generic
name shards. Exact material and icon checks prevent unrelated shards from
being selected.

3rd Person View commands

When WU-third_person_view is installed and exposes its Keybinder command
catalog, the editor adds a 3rd Person View category. This optional integration
does not add a hard dependency on that mod.

Put the action queue on either side of the screen

Hello, SKLOTOPOLIS!

Keybinder 0.7.5 lets you place the compact Queue Monitor on either the right or
left edge of the screen. Its complete layout mirrors automatically, including
the drawer direction, lamps, text, border, and header arrow.

What is new in 0.7.5?

Left or right screen edge

Open the Keybinder window and use Queue monitor → Right edge / Left edge
beside the action queue limit. The choice takes effect immediately and is saved
for the next launch.

On the left edge the panel is fully mirrored:

  • the panel opens toward the center of the screen;
  • the lamp and arrow column moves to the panel's right side;
  • the arrow reverses its open and close directions;
  • action, Tool, and Target text is right-aligned beside the lamps;
  • the inner border moves to the correct side.

Expanded header

When the panel is open, the space above the action rows displays the localized
Queue monitor title. The collapsed strip remains minimal and shows only its
direction arrow and Build Menu-style queue lamps.

See your action queue and cancel queued actions before they start

Hello, SKLOTOPOLIS!

Keybinder 0.7.4 adds a compact Wurm-styled action queue monitor, safer target
validation, and German localization. It also lets you mark a later queued
action for cancellation: Keybinder remembers the request and stops that action
as soon as Wurm starts it.

What is new in 0.7.4?

Compact action queue monitor

  • A compact strip sits against the right edge and shows up to ten native Build
    Menu queue lamps.
  • Click the left arrow above the lamps to slide the panel open. It changes to a
    right arrow for closing the panel.
  • The expanded panel shows each action with its Tool and Target, and sizes
    itself to the displayed text.
  • Click a lit lamp to cancel that action. If it is a later server-queue entry,
    Keybinder remembers the request and sends Stop when it becomes current.

Safer execution and queue handling

  • Sources and targets are validated against Wurm's action rules before an
    action is sent.
  • Impossible combinations are skipped with a clear Event message.
  • Queue capacity is checked step by step against currently available slots.
  • Long saved chains are no longer disabled only because their total
    theoretical cost exceeds the character's queue limit.
  • Hover matching, nearby resolution, batch queue costs, Embark/Disembark, and
    managed bind restoration were corrected.

Localization

  • Added complete German localization alongside English and Brazilian
    Portuguese.

One key, many actions — now with portable tool filters and smooth scrolling

Hello, SKLOTOPOLIS!

Keybinder 0.7.3 is ready for testing.

This is a small update with several fixes and a useful new option for actions
that need materials from your inventory — for example, finding a sprout and
using it to plant.

What is new in 0.7.3?

Inventory + filter tools

This is helpful when an action must use a material stored in your inventory as
its Tool. For example, you can plant whatever sprout you have or create kindling
from whatever suitable wood scrap is available.

It is simple to use:

  1. Select Tool → Inventory + filter. Keybinder asks you to choose a filter
    item; click a sprout.
  2. When you press the keybind, Keybinder searches your inventory for any
    matching sprout and selects it.
  3. The selected sprout is used for the action — in this example, Plant.

The command stores the item's normalized short type as a portable filter. At
execution time it searches in this order:

  • toolbelt;
  • direct player inventory;
  • nested containers.

Smart Improve became faster

Smart Improve was optimized to calculate its success-rate predictions faster.

Smooth mouse-wheel scrolling

Thanks to Zeex, the bug affecting mouse-wheel scrolling in large keybind
lists was found and fixed. The list no longer jumps back toward the top.

What is new in 0.7.2?

Archaeology Identify

The new dedicated Archaeology Identify step selects the correct brush or
chisel for each unidentified fragment. It can search the toolbelt only or the
toolbelt followed by loaded inventory containers, and fills only the free part
of the character's action queue.

Smarter Smart Improve

Smart Improve now logs the target QL, estimated Improve success chance, and the
conditional chance of advancing to the next rarity level after a rarity
drumroll. The estimates use the live crafting catalog and character data
available to the client.

Fixes and improvements

  • Hitched and renamed wagons can be used as Smart Improve targets.
  • Examined world objects provide Smart Improve with their target data.
  • Rift stone shards are protected from selection as ordinary rock shards.
  • Stone chisel and carving knife identification uses the actual item type.
  • Improve actions for cold metal targets are rejected locally with a clear
    message.
  • Smart Improve source, failure, and debug logging is clearer.
  • HUD Multi supports a single action and selectors close when no longer needed.
  • Between-server travel and server-specific keybind restoration are more
    reliable.
  • Hovered, nearby, and inventory filters use clearer, more consistent matching.

Wurm Keybinder

Keybinder 0.6.1 for Wurm Unlimited

Tired of managing keybinds through console commands, juggling toolbelt setup
files, and remembering dozens of keys? Keybinder replaces all of that with one
clear in-game window. All your keybinds are visible in one place, where you can
create, edit, disable, or delete them without digging through configuration
files or memorizing commands.

A single key can perform an entire routine. Start recording, carry out the
actions normally, and Keybinder will remember them for you. Want a key for
bashing stumps or smelting items? Easy. Want to chop anything in your kitchen
with just one key? Easy. You can even assign several keybinds to the same key
and switch between them in-game with a one-second long press. Keep all your
favorite actions on one key and select the one you need without becoming a
keyboard pianist.

Keybinder even makes the mouse wheel useful: bind it to actions such as moving
and rotating objects. Less console work, less clicking, fewer keys to remember:
just press a key or turn the wheel and get back to playing.

What's new in 0.6.1

  • Target selection is now more reliable across inventories, containers, the
    toolbelt, equipment, and the game world. Keybinder can select a tool from
    your backpack automatically.
  • Added Import Wurm keybinds and Prepare mod removal controls to the
    main window. Keybinder can restore imported commands without overwriting
    keys that now belong to something else.
  • Movement, camera, and essential HUD controls are excluded from import, so
    Keybinder does not take ownership of Wurm's fundamental controls.
  • Complete English and Brazilian Portuguese localization with a persistent
    Wurm-styled language selector and a safe English fallback. More languages
    are welcome!
  • There are now two ways to add an action: perform it and let Keybinder record
    it, or choose it from the complete list of vanilla actions.
  • Keybinder checks the available action queue before it starts. If the entire
    keybind cannot fit, nothing is sent. Empty your queue and press the key again.
  • Repeated Push and Push gently actions retain the selected object across
    every server-side recreation. Finally, you can push, push, push, and keep
    going.
  • An unavailable target skips only its own step and writes the reason to the
    system Event tab. The remaining steps continue in their saved order.
  • Missing nearby targets are skipped silently. If a target is visible but
    outside the action range, Keybinder writes a useful "come closer" message to
    the Event tab.
  • Your current mount or vehicle can now be used as a target. Want to disembark
    or open a cart hold with one key? Easy.
  • All your accounts can use the same keybind list.
  • Embarking on a vehicle turns your view to face the same direction as the vehicle.

Attribution

Keybinder began as derivative work based on bdew's
Custom Actions, licensed under
LGPL-3.0-or-later.

The Smart Improve feature is a clean-room reimplementation inspired by the
complete Improved Improve mod lineage. Special thanks to:

  • Munsta0, who created
    the original Improved Improve client mod;
  • inniria, who rewrote and extended it
    as i2improve;
  • Snidor, who continued i2improve and
    whose 0.2.1 release was used as the final research baseline.

No source code from these Improved Improve mods is bundled.
